<p class="p__0">Chemical substance Polyether ether ketone (PEEK) is a colourless natural polymer in the polyaryletherketone (PAEK) household, utilized in engineering applications. The polymer was first established in November 1978, later on being introduced to the market by Victrex PLC, then Imperial Chemical Industries (ICI) in the early 1980s. Synthesis [edit] PEEK polymers are obtained by step-growth polymerization by the dialkylation of bisphenolate salts.</p>

<p class="p__1">The reaction is conducted around 300 C in polar aprotic solvents - such as diphenyl sulfone. Properties [modify] PEEK is a semicrystalline thermoplastic with exceptional mechanical and chemical resistance properties that are kept to heats. <p class="p__2">6 GPa and its tensile strength is 90 to 100 MPa. PEEK has a glass transition temperature of around 143 C (289 F) and melts around 343 C (662 F). Some grades have a helpful operating temperature level of approximately 250 C (482 F). The thermal conductivity increases almost linearly with temperature in between room temperature and solidus temperature level.</p>
<br>
<p class="p__3">It is attacked by halogens and strong Brnsted and Lewis acids, in addition to some halogenated compounds and aliphatic hydrocarbons at heats. It is soluble in focused sulfuric acid at space temperature, although dissolution can take a very long time unless the polymer remains in a kind with a high surface-area-to-volume ratio, such as a fine powder or thin film.</p>

<p class="p__5">PEEK is used in back fusion devices and reinforcing rods. It is radiolucent, however it is hydrophobic triggering it to not completely fuse with bone. PEEK seals and manifolds are typically utilized in fluid applications. PEEK also performs well in heat applications (as much as 500 F/260 C). Since of this and its low thermal conductivity, it is likewise utilized in FFF printing to thermally separate the hot end from the cold end.</p>
